    Turkey Nacho Casserole

    *****

    Ingredients

    • 5  cups slightly crushed tortilla chips
    • 4  cups cubed cooked turkey or chicken
    • 2  16-ounce jars salsa
    • 1  10-ounce package frozen whole kernel corn
    • 1/2  cup dairy sour cream
    • 2  tablespoons all-purpose flour
    • 1/2 cup jalapeno pepper slices
    • 2  cups  shredded Monterey Jack cheese or mozzarella cheese

    Directions

    1. Lightly grease a 13x9x2-inch baking dish or 3-quart rectangular casserole. Place 3 cups of the tortilla chips in bottom of dish. In a large bowl combine turkey, salsa, corn, sour cream, and flour; spoon over tortilla chips. Top with jalapenos. 

    2. Bake, uncovered, in a 350 degree F oven for 25 minutes. Sprinkle with the remaining 2 cups tortilla chips and the cheese. Bake, uncovered, for 5 to 10 minutes more or until heated through. Makes 8 servings.

    To Tote: Cover tightly. Transport in an insulated carrier.
